Peanut Butter Playdough Recipe:

  • Sharebar
Print Friendly

Playing with playdoh is fun, and if you can eat the playdoh when you are done, it can be even more fun.  It is also a good way to play with food for kids that have problems with eating.

Ingredients:

1 cup of smooth/creamy peanut butter
2 cups of powdered sugar
1/2 cup honey
Mix all the ingredients together – if it seems a little too dry at first, you can stick it in the microwave for a few seconds to melt the peanut butter a bit. Once you start kneading it and playing with it it will soften up to the perfect consistency :)
